#f4480d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4480d is composed of 95.7% red, 28.2%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.5% magenta, 94.7%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 15.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 50.4%. #f4480d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ff901a with #e90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

● #f4480d color description : Vivid orange.
#f4480d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f4480d has RGB values of R:244, G:72,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.95,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16009229.

Shades and Tints of #f4480d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fef2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#f4480d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#897c78 is the less saturated color, while #fe4303 is the most saturated one.
